## Limits & Quotas — Pointsmith Ledger

Quick reference for when members ask why a points transaction bounced. The Pointsmith ledger caps how fast points can be earned, redeemed, or transferred — mostly to stop fraud rings, partly to keep the nightly reconciliation job sane. If a customer hits a cap, it resets at midnight local time. The current limits are set as constants, listed below.

tuning constants:
QUOTAS = {
    "druwyn": 5,
    "holix": 5,
    "zorath": 5,
    "holwyn": 10,
}

## Cold Start Approvals

Any change to the Quillbend serverless handlers that could affect cold-start latency (runtime bumps, dependency additions, memory tier changes) requires approval before merge. Benchmarks must be attached to the request, captured against the staging pool. Emergency patches still need retroactive approval within two days. Approvals are granted by the maintainer named below.

account owner for bawip-tahag: Raleth Quenok

Subject: Canary gating cut-over complete

Team — the Brightmoor deploy pipeline now gates canaries on error-rate and latency deltas rather than raw thresholds. Rollbacks trigger automatically after two consecutive failed windows. Old manual approvals are retired. For future maintainers auditing this change, the gating configuration now in effect is recorded below.

settings of tagef-bawif:
DRUIX_HOST=druix.zemvarlabs.internal
DRUIX_PORT=8000

Step 4: Before tagging the Lanternfold report builder release, verify that the column sorter uses a stable sort. Reviewers should confirm that rows with equal sort keys retain their original ingestion order, since the Quarterly Rollup template depends on this for tie-breaking. Run the fixture suite in reports/sorting_stability and attach the output to the review. Once the suite passes, sign the build artifact with the key below.

rollout seal: bky4_x7Gc